人类社会正处于显著的数字化转型阶段,人类活动系统的基本特征与内在机理正在发生重大变化,特别是虚拟空间中的活动日渐多元化与自我体系化,并更加主动和频繁地与实体空间活动产生着十分复杂的互动。目前关于人类活动系统数字化转型的研究愈发重视虚拟空间中行为的多样性与复杂性,强调超越虚实二元的对立视角,将技术使用作为活动系统不可分割的一部分。本文提出城市虚拟空间活动系统与城市虚实活动系统的概念,一方面强调城市虚拟空间活动已逐渐形成相对独立系统的趋势,另一方面则聚焦于城市虚实空间活动系统的互动关系,并且从理论上构建城市虚实活动系统,以便深化理解城市活动系统的数字化转型并提出相关的政策建议。本文从理论和方法创新、实证议题创新以及应用实践创新等侧面,系统论述城市虚实活动系统的概念体系与研究内容框架,为数字化转型下的城市空间提供新的理论与方法,为智慧城市生活圈规划与数字生活治理提供科学参考。

Human society is currently in the stage of significant digital transformation. The basic characteristics and internal mechanisms of human activity systems are undergoing major transitions. In particular, activities in virtual space are becoming diversified and self-systematical, and they more actively and frequently interact with the activities in the physical space in a complex way. At present, research on the digital transformation of human activity system increasingly emphasizes the variation and complexity of the behavior in virtual space. The research also highlights the necessity to go beyond the duality of physical and virtual space and to integrate technological use with activity system. This paper innovatively proposes the concepts of urban virtual space activity system and urban physical-virtual activity system. On the one hand, the new concepts emphasize the characteristics of urban virtual space activity that it increasingly becomes an independent activity system (of urban physical space activity). On the other hand, the concepts focus on the interaction relationships between urban physical and virtual activity systems. The theoretical construction of urban physical-virtual activity system can deepen the understanding of the digital transformation of urban activity system and further provide policy implications. This paper systematically states and discusses the conceptual and research frameworks of urban physical-virtual activity system in the dimensions of theoretical and methodological innovation, empirical topics innovation, and practical innovation. The concept and elements of urban physical-virtual activity system can provide new theories and methods to analyze urban space in digital transformation, and scientific support for urban life circle planning in smart cities and governance of digital life.
